FUCHS acquires lubricants business of Gleitmo Technik AB

The Fuchs Group, headquartered in Mannheim, Germany, and the world’s largest independent lubricant manufacturer, has signed an agreement to acquire the lubricants business of Gleitmo Technik AB in Kungsbacka, Sweden.

The newly acquired business will be integrated into its subsidiary Fuchs Lubricants Sweden AB as of July 1, 2021.

Fuchs acquired 100% of the shares in Gleitmo Technik AB through a share purchase agreement (SPA) which includes the customer base, the product portfolio, the workforce and a lease agreement of the Gleitmo office and warehouse in Kungsbacka in particular.

The bundling of sales channel makes Fuchs Lubricants Sweden AB a central and authoritative partner for all lubricants and related specialties in Sweden and the Nordic Region.

As a longstanding trading partner of Fuchs, Gleitmo Technik AB generated sales revenues of around EUR6 million (USD7.3 million) in the financial year 2020. The company currently employs 10 people.
